I have 4 forum categories, and subforums under those. Up until today I had no problems assigning moderating permissions to the group "Moderators" When I went to change permissions on the forums today I was met with the following. Please help, thank you.
Code:SQL Error : 1064 You have an error in your SQL syntax; check the manual that corresponds to your MySQL server version for the right syntax to use near ') AND aa.group_id = ug.group_id AND aa.auth_mod = 1 GROUP BY ug.user_' at line 3
SELECT ug.user_id, COUNT(auth_mod) AS is_auth_mod FROM nuke_bbauth_access aa, nuke_bbuser_group ug WHERE ug.user_id IN () AND aa.group_id = ug.group_id AND aa.auth_mod = 1 GROUP BY ug.user_id
Line : 559
File : admin_ug_auth.php

Yes, the script worked correctly. It should allow you to assign moderators.
For administrators, that may be a separate issue. You may need to go to the users table directly and set your user_level = 2 |
